Making April is an American indie pop group formed in 2018. Their music is characterized by catchy melodies and introspective lyrics, creating an atmospheric soundscape reminiscent of artists like The xx and Beach House. They have released two albums: "Runaway World" (2019) and its remastered version "Runaway World (Re-Release)" (2020). Some of their most representative tracks include "Runaway World", "Lost in the City", and "Golden Hour".
